Media Roots Radio - Fukushima Coverage & Break Down of Radiation

Robbie and Abby Martin host a special 90 minute edition of Media Roots Radio covering Japan's Fukushima nuclear disaster with guests Shing02 and Anthony Bisset. Shing02 and Anthony cover the state of the reactors, the radiation levels, dangers and breakdown of compounds, government cover ups and media disinformation, the science of nuclear energy and how one can prepare for a nuclear fallout. Anthony Bisset is a composer and improviser working in all genres of electronic music who designs his own software and hardware for live performance. Since 2007 he has been a part time resident and regular performer in Tokyo and has played shows from Hokkaido to the Southern islands. Having his extended family and friends in Tokyo threatened by nuclear fallout, Anthony has been heavily researching Fukushima since the March 11th disaster. A consummate infophile this is not his first encounter with nuclear science. More about him at www.anthonybisset.com Shing02 is a rap activist, peace advocate, and inventor. Born in Tokyo 1975, Shing02 landed in the SF Bay Area at the age of 15. He became immersed in the local hip-hop scene that launched dozens of acts worldwide, and in '96, Shingo’s music made its way back to Japan. He gained a lot of support from his homeland and partnered with Mr. Higo of Mary Joy Recordings. He currently lives in LA and works with artists on both sides of the Pacific. Media Roots Radio - Two Soldiers Speak Out

This is a special Media Roots Radio interview conducted by Abby and Robbie Martin with two active duty soldiers in the army: Malcolm and Yossarian. Malcolm is a soldier enlisted in the US Army and serves as an aviation mechanic. Yossarian is an Apache helicopter pilot and military aviator in the US Army. They are both stationed abroad right now but were gracious enough to take some time out of their schedule to sit down on Skpe for an interview with Media Roots. They talk about why they enlisted and give their perspective on Bradley Manning, US foreign policy and the current political climate. They are also both contributing writers for Media Roots. Media Roots Radio - Interview with Key Eyewitness to "Underwear Bomber" False Flag

Abby and Robbie Martin conduct an exclusive interview with Kurt Haskell, attorney and key eyewitness to the "Underwear Bomber" incident which happened on December 25, 2010. Kurt maintains that he witnessed a well dressed man argue with security and escort Umar Farouk Abdulmutallab, or the "Underwear Bomber", on their flight without a passport. Kurt discusses the subsequent government and media cover up about the event and talks about how being a witness to a false flag attack changed his political perspective and caused him to question the entire "War on Terror".
